Answers:
我在BinaryDriverHowto页面上的“ 没有X的安装”标题下找到了解决方法。
您可以运行sudo ubuntu-drivers devices
以查看检测到的驱动程序,并用来apt
自己安装它们。这是该页面上列出的示例:
sudo ubuntu-drivers devices
== /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 ==
vendor : NVIDIA Corporation
modalias : pci:v000010DEd00000DDAsv000017AAsd000021D1bc03sc00i00
model : GF106GLM [Quadro 2000M]
driver : xserver-xorg-video-nouveau - distro free builtin
driver : nvidia-304-updates - distro non-free
driver : nvidia-304 - distro non-free
driver : nvidia-331 - distro non-free recommended
driver : nvidia-331-updates - distro non-free
sudo apt-get install nvidia-331
要回答您的第一个问题(“有人遇到这个问题”),答案是“是的-我。
仍在自己寻找一种解决方案(第二个问题),如果找到答案,我将对其进行编辑。
编辑:我终于找到有关此问题的错误报告。
编辑:中的注释提供了快速修复/解决方法:
sudo update-apt-xapian-index
您可能还需要安装apt-xapian-index
软件包,因为apt-xapian-index
从镜像中消失的软件包在16.04中未被注意到。据报道,该软件包已添加回yakkety。
不幸的是,尽管它已经使用了4个月,并且发现了一个线索,但没有人为其分配解决方案。该错误已修复。
sudo update-apt-xapian-index
,即可恢复工作:-)谢谢!
我收到的最初答案适用于笔记本电脑,但不适用于台式机。我的笔记本电脑使用Nvidia,台式机使用AMD。如果您使用的是AMD GPU,请阅读以下内容。
目前,尚不支持fglrx,我不知道它将来是否会回来。对于使用AMD GPU的人来说,这意味着我们将使用开源驱动程序。
在终端中运行以下命令以列出您的PCI设备:
lspci
这将吐出很多行,在其中您应该看到与这一行相似的行:
7:00.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Tahiti XT [Radeon HD 7970/8970 OEM / R9 280X]
这样做的目的是找出您的GPU模型,这是您应该知道的。下一条命令会吐出大量信息,这是您永远不会忘记的信息。如果您仔细阅读,将会发现原因。
man radeon
一直走到终端的底部,您将看到类似以下内容:
X Version 11 xf86-video-ati 7.7.0
这是开源的AMD驱动程序,并且处于活动状态。
该特定答案的全部要点是通知人们,默认情况下,您应该在系统上为AMD GPU安装并激活开源驱动程序。对于其他驾驶员,该问题的原始答案仍然有效。